The pandemic created a fundamental change in how we view our home connectivity, both in terms of reliability and quality. Simultaneously, an aging population and a consequent need for increased home health care gave rise to two SCTE working groups, one for Aging in Place and the other for Telehealth. This workshop covers both angles. CommScope’s CTO / Home Networks, Charles Cheevers, returns to the Expo stage to relate the results of a 2,000-person work-from-home survey, resulting in some interesting considerations about how to optimize WiFi performance and security, hybrid access gateways, and augmentation. Next, Duke Tech Solutions' Sudheer Dharanikota delves into the Telecom for Health (T4H) opportunity for operators, with use cases for improved healthcare metrics that demonstrate the value cable operators bring to the table.
